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PIQ000 - Messages in Development Class PMIQ
Message number: 581
Message text: Data for calculation of average grade is incomplete
The average grade cannot be calculated because data is incomplete or
incorrect.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- Data for calculation of average grade is incomplete ?The SAP error message HRPIQ000581 indicates that there is incomplete data for the calculation of the average grade in the context of the SAP Human Capital Management (HCM) module, particularly in the area of personnel administration or employee qualifications.
Cause:
The error typically arises due to one or more of the following reasons:
- Missing Data: Required fields for calculating the average grade are not filled in. This could include missing grades, dates, or other relevant information in the employee's qualification records.
- Incorrect Configuration: The system may not be properly configured to handle the grading system being used, leading to incomplete data being processed.
- Data Entry Errors: There may be errors in the data entry process, such as incorrect or incomplete entries in the qualification records.
- Inconsistent Data: There may be inconsistencies in the data, such as overlapping date ranges for qualifications or grades that do not match expected formats.
Solution:
To resolve the HRPIQ000581 error, you can take the following steps:
Check Qualification Records:
- Navigate to the employee's qualification records in the SAP system.
- 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ly, including grades, dates, and any other relevant information.
Review Configuration:
- Check the configuration settings for the grading system in the SAP HCM module. Ensure that the grading schema is correctly set up and that all necessary parameters are defined.
Data Validation:
- Validate the data entries for any inconsistencies or errors. Look for overlapping dates or incorrect grade formats that may cause issues in calculations.
Consult Documentation:
-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on how to set up and maintain qualification records and grading systems.
Testing:
- After making corrections, test the calculation of the average grade again to ensure that the error has been resolved.
